Lake Isabella Man Arrested for Child Porn

LAKE ISABELLA — A 28-year-old Lake Isabella man was arrested on Thursday of last week after being accused of possessing child pornography.

Joseph Barton-Mete, was booked into the Kern County Jail for possession of matter depicting minor engaged in sexual conduct. He is being held on $200,000 bail.

According to the Kern County Sheriff’s Office, the nearly two-year-long investigation into allegations that Barton-Mete was in possession of child pornography, began back in December 2014.

During their investigation deputies said they were able to gather enough evidence to obtain a search warrant for Barton-Mete’s residence, which they executed in late 2015, seizing computers from the home.

Authorities said that the computers were sent to the FBI to be analyzed, and on January 7, they were notified by agents that numerous videos depicting child pornography had been located on a computer which had been seized.

Later that day deputies obtained an arrest warrant for Barton-Mete and took him into custody without incident.
